Understanding Acai and Its Superfood Status
What Is Acai?
Acai berries grow on acai palm trees (Euterpe oleracea) in the Amazon rainforest. These small, dark purple berries are about the size of a grape, with a thin edible layer surrounding a large pit. Unlike sweet berries, acai has a unique, earthy flavor with hints of chocolate and red wine. In Brazil, it’s often blended into creamy smoothie bowls or served as a refreshing juice, especially in regions like Pará and Amazonas.
Acai is a functional food, meaning it provides health benefits beyond basic nutrition. According to a 2020 study in Nutrients, acai is rich in:
- Antioxidants: Anthocyanins and polyphenols combat free radicals.
- Healthy fats: Omega-3, -6, and -9 support heart and brain health.
- Fiber: Promotes digestion and satiety.
- Vitamins and minerals: Vitamin C, vitamin A, and iron boost immunity and energy.

How to Enjoy Acai in Your Diet
Where to Find Acai
Acai is perishable, so it’s typically sold frozen, dried, or as a powder outside Brazil. Look for:
- Frozen acai puree: In grocery stores (e.g., Sambazon brand).
- Acai powder: For smoothies or baking (e.g., Navitas Organics).
- Acai juice: Check for low-sugar options.
Recipe 1: Classic Acai Smoothie Bowl
Ingredients (serves 1):
- 1 packet (100g) frozen acai puree
- 1/2 banana
- 1/4 cup almond milk
- Toppings: Granola, sliced strawberries, chia seeds
Instructions:
- Blend acai, banana, and almond milk until smooth.
- Pour into a bowl and add toppings.
- Enjoy for breakfast or a snack.
Benefits: Boosts energy by 12%, per 2019 Journal of Functional Foods.
Recipe 2: Acai Energy Smoothie
Ingredients (serves 1, ~12 oz):
- 1 tbsp acai powder
- 1 cup frozen berries
- 1/2 cup spinach
- 1 cup coconut water
- Optional: 1 tsp honey
Instructions:
- Blend all ingredients until creamy.
- Sip mid-morning for a vitality boost.
- Store in a mason jar for on-the-go.
Benefits: Reduces oxidative stress by 20%, per 2020 Antioxidants.
Recipe 3: Acai Chia Pudding
Ingredients (serves 2):
- 2 tbsp acai powder
- 1/4 cup chia seeds
- 1 cup almond milk
- Toppings: Sliced almonds, blueberries
Instructions:
- Mix acai powder, chia seeds, and almond milk in a bowl.
- Refrigerate for 4 hours or overnight.
- Top with almonds and blueberries before serving.
Benefits: Improves gut health by 10%, per 2019 Food & Function.

Cautions and Considerations
- Moderation: Acai is nutrient-dense but high in calories; stick to 100–200g daily.
- Allergies: Rare, but test small amounts if prone to berry allergies.
- Sugar content: Choose unsweetened acai to avoid blood sugar spikes.
- Not a cure: Acai supports health but doesn’t replace medical treatment.
- Quality matters: Buy from reputable brands to ensure purity.
